ALEXANDRIA, Va., June 18 -- United States Patent no. 12,328,781, issued on June 10, was assigned to Telefonaktiebolaget LM Ericsson (Publ) (Stockholm).
"Master node, a secondary node, a user equipment and methods therein for handling of a secondary cell group (SCG)" was invented by Osman Nuri Can Yilmaz (Espoo, Finland), Lian Araujo (Solna, Sweden), Patrik Rugeland (Stockholm) and Oumer Teyeb (Solna, Sweden).
